Choke Problems - Won't Open

Can anyone explain to me in simple terms how to adjust the hot air choke on my quadrajet? For whatever reason it's not opening up and causing the truck to flood out. It's a rebuild from Guaranteed Carb and only has about an hour of run time on it so everything is correct, free and should work. The choke cover is blank and doesn't have the standard markings. I attempted adjust it cold to stay open about an 1/8" in but if I get that far the butterfly just flies open. Do I hold the choke closed and adjust lean until the linkage starts forcing the butterfly open or do I adjust from the lean sided and richen until the doors close to 1/8"? Totally F++kin' confused!

Before anyone asks has new: Plugs, wires, cap, rotor, coil, vacuum hoses, unused carb ports have new caps, open headers, fuel pump & hoses from steel line to engine. Engine was running albeit rich and somewhat rough before any modifications were made. Timing was not changed and hasn't been checked yet. Carb has not been adjusted in anyway other than attempting to adjust the choke.
